The Essence of Ribbed Brad Nails

Ribbed brad nails, a pioneering variant of conventional brad nails, are distinguished by their unique design, which incorporates small ridges along the shank. These subtle yet vital ridges contribute to a remarkable enhancement in the overall grip and holding power of the nail. The ribbed feature acts as an anchor, firmly securing the nail within the wood material, thereby substantially reducing the risks of dislodgment or loosening over time.

Advantages Over Traditional Nails

  1. Enhanced Holding Power: The incorporation of ribbing along the brad nail‘s shank amplifies its capacity to firmly grasp the wood fibers, providing superior holding power compared to regular brad nails. This feature ensures increased stability and durability of the installed structures, reducing the need for frequent maintenance or re-nailing.
  2. Mitigated Splitting: Ribbed brad nails effectively minimize the occurrence of wood splitting during the nailing process. The presence of ridges enables smoother insertion, decreasing the likelihood of disruptive cracks, and preserving the structural integrity of the wood, especially in delicate or dense wood types.
  3. Improved Aesthetics: The utilization of ribbed brad nails contributes to a more visually appealing finish. The reduced likelihood of surface blemishes, such as splintering or chipping, results in a cleaner and more professional appearance, accentuating the overall craftsmanship and attention to detail in the final woodwork.

Application and Best Practices for Ribbed Brad Nails

Selecting the Appropriate Ribbed Brad Nail

When choosing ribbed brad nails for a specific woodworking project, it is imperative to consider the material composition of the wood, the thickness of the material, and the intended purpose of the fastening. Opting for the correct length and gauge of the nail ensures optimal performance and long-term structural integrity. Additionally, selecting galvanized or stainless-steel options can provide added resistance to corrosion, extending the lifespan of the fastening solution.

Best Practices for Installation

  1. Pre-Drilling: To facilitate smooth insertion and minimize the risk of splitting, pre-drilling pilot holes is recommended, particularly for hardwoods and dense materials. This step ensures precise placement and reduces the stress on the wood fibers during the nailing process.
  2. Utilizing Pneumatic Nailers: Leveraging pneumatic nail guns equipped with appropriate settings for ribbed brad nails optimizes the efficiency and accuracy of installation. Adjusting the air pressure to accommodate the nail’s specifications and employing sequential firing mode can further enhance the control and precision during the fastening procedure.
  3. Angle and Depth Control: Maintaining a consistent angle of application and regulating the depth of the nails through depth adjustment mechanisms are critical for achieving a seamless, flush finish. This practice not only enhances the structural stability of the fastening but also contributes to a visually appealing surface without any protruding nail heads.
